On Fri, May 04, 2007 at 10:32:00PM +0200, Javier Rodríguez Sánchez wrote:
> Hello, I have tried the patch and it works well, but I have one question.
> It's necessary to be a MBR partition scheme? because I need a MBR
> emulation from the GPT scheme to Grub2 loader works. If I only let the GPT
> scheme with the EFI protective partition on MBR, grub doesn't find any
> bootable device.
This patch is intended for systems using PC/BIOS/MBR boot system, whose
"standard" partition layout is msdos-style, but have opted to use GPT instead
for the partitions.
GPT is the standard in EFI, but this patch shouldn't have any effect on EFI
systems (these already have GPT support).
